The Metaphysics of Paradox
Jainism, Absolute Relativity, and Religious Pluralism (Explorations in Indic Traditions: Theological, Ethical, and Philosophical)
by Wm. Andrew Schwartz
Hardcover, 238 Pages, Published 2018 by Lexington Books
ISBN-13: 978-1-4985-6392-5, ISBN: 1-4985-6392-9

"This book is an exploration into the paradoxical structure of pluralistic thinking as illuminated by both Western and Eastern insights--especially Jainism. By calling into question the most fundamental assumptions of religious pluralists, the author hopes to contribute to a paradigm shift in discourse on religious pluralism and conflicting truth claims."
